School Overview
Auburn Riverside High School, located in Auburn, Washington, is a prominent secondary institution serving the Auburn School District. Known for its comprehensive academic curriculum and vibrant extracurricular culture, the school places a strong emphasis on preparing students for post-secondary success through a variety of Advanced Placement (AP) courses, career and technical education (CTE) programs, and robust support systems. The campus serves a diverse student body, fostering an environment that encourages both intellectual growth and personal development within the local community.
Beyond academics, Auburn Riverside is widely recognized for its strong school spirit and active participation in Washington Interscholastic Activities Association (WIAA) athletics. The school offers a wide array of sports teams, arts programs, and student-led clubs that contribute to a well-rounded educational experience. By integrating community engagement with high standards for student achievement, Auburn Riverside High School strives to cultivate a safe, inclusive, and collaborative environment that empowers students to reach their full potential.
